Biography

Rascoe Dean is a former federal prosecutor and experienced trial and appellate lawyer whose practice focuses on complex civil litigation, white collar criminal defense, government and internal investigations, and regulatory compliance.

Rascoe represents individuals, companies, and non-profits in civil matters and a broad range of investigative, regulatory, and enforcement matters before the Department of Justice, state authorities, and other regulatory agencies. He recently represented Kilmar Abrego Garcia in his federal criminal prosecution in the Middle District of Tennessee, helping secure dismissal of the charges on grounds of vindictive prosecution. The New York Times and The Washington Post described the dismissal, respectively, as “a stinging rebuke of . . . the Justice Department,” and as “an extraordinary defeat” for the federal government.

Prior to joining Sherrard Roe Voigt & Harbison, Rascoe served for seven years as a federal prosecutor in the United States Attorney’s Office (USAO) for the Middle District of Tennessee, where he handled hundreds of cases and served as lead counsel in multiple federal jury trials. He also conducted numerous investigations with federal and state law enforcement agencies, including the Federal Bureau of Investigation, the Drug Enforcement Administration, the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ms, and Explosives, Homeland Security Investigations, the Department of Health and Human Services, the Tennessee Bureau of Investigation, the Tennessee Highway Patrol, and the Metropolitan Nashville Police Department.

Rascoe also held multiple leadership roles at the USAO. As Deputy Criminal Chief of the General Crimes Section, he supervised a group of federal prosecutors handling cases involving firearms, violent crimes, threats, illegal narcotics, and child exploitation offenses. He also served as the office’s Appellate Chief, supervising all of the office’s criminal and civil appellate litigation, drafting and reviewing numerous briefs, helping resolve many of the office’s most complex and sensitive legal issues, and arguing multiple appeals before the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it.

Before entering government service, Rascoe was an associate at Sherrard Roe Voigt & Harbison, and clerked for the Honorable Gilbert S. Merritt of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Sixth Circuit. Rascoe earned his law degree from Vanderbilt University Law School in 2015, where he served as an Articles Editor of the Vanderbilt Law Review. Before law school, he taught tenth and eleventh grade English and coached high school baseball in Memphis, Tennessee through Teach For America. He holds a B.A. in political science from Sewanee: The University of the South.

Rascoe serves as an adjunct professor of law at Vanderbilt University Law School, and is active in the community, serving on the Board of Trustees for Montgomery Bell Academy and as a board member for Teach For America Nashville-Chattanooga, the Joe C. Davis YMCA Outdoor Center, and the Nashville Public Library Foundation. He previously served on the board of Valor Collegiate Academies.
